WebOct 11, 2024 · What is a MEC? A MEC is a policy that meets the section 7702A definition of life insurance and is funded more rapidly than a paid-up policy based on seven statutorily-defined level annual premiums. The basic rules are: Policies entered into before June 21, 1988, are grandfathered from the MEC rules unless the policies undergo a material change.

By definition, a single premium whole life policy is a Modified Endowment Contract, or MEC, if entered into past June 20, 1988. A MEC is defined as such because it exceeds the IRS limits (based on a “7-pay test”) for the amount of cash a policyholder can put into a life insurance contract. computer keeps thinking i hit the touchscreenWebIn addition, if the policy owner is under age 59½, a 10% tax penalty may be assessed on the amount withdrawn from a MEC that”s includible as income unless an exception applies. Example: You purchased a cash value life insurance policy with a single premium of $100,000, making the policy a MEC.
